Less.js 3.0 正式版发布,可能是最受欢迎的 CSS 框架

红薯
 红薯
发布于 2018年02月12日
收藏 6

Less.js 发布了 3.0 正式版,该版本改进内容包括:

  • Fix calc() function to not do math operations on compile

  • Rename Directive -> AtRule & Rule -> Declaration

  • Cross-platform @plugin loading! (Node & Browser)

  • Numerous changes / improvements to plugin architecture

  • Simplified API calls in plugins (less.atrule() vs new less.tree.AtRule())

  • Property accessors ($width to refer to width: 300px value)

  • Inline JavaScript disabled by default for security reasons (use @plugin)

  • Improvements in Less error reporting

  • Added feature: returning null / false from Less functions will remove that line

  • Simple boolean() and if() functions added

  • Bug fixes

  • Removal of unnecessary nodes from API (like IE's alpha())

Less CSS 是一个使用广泛的 CSS 预处理器,通过简单的语法和变量对 CSS 进行扩展,可减少很多 CSS 的代码量。

LESS 将 CSS 赋予了动态语言的特性,如 变量, 继承, 运算, 函数. LESS 既可以在 客户端 上运行 (支持IE 6+, Webkit, Firefox),也可一在服务端运行 (借助 Node.js).

本站文章除注明转载外,均为本站原创或编译。欢迎任何形式的转载,但请务必注明出处,尊重他人劳动共创开源社区。
转载请注明:文章转载自 开源中国社区 [http://www.oschina.net]
本文标题:Less.js 3.0 正式版发布,可能是最受欢迎的 CSS 框架
加载中

精彩评论

乐悠族
乐悠族
:bowtie: 除了嵌套、定义之外,几乎用不到其他特性。。

最新评论(11

千一
千一
cssnext
陈少鑫
陈少鑫
虽说scss更加强大,但对于我来说,Less真的够用了。
av
av

引用来自“乐悠族”的评论

:bowtie: 除了嵌套、定义之外,几乎用不到其他特性。。
+1
乐悠族
乐悠族
:bowtie: 除了嵌套、定义之外,几乎用不到其他特性。。
开源中国首席罗纳尔多
开源中国首席罗纳尔多
你们写css也用sass?
pauli
pauli
calc 等了几年了
s
sparkleMan
用 stylus 飘过
獜彝
獜彝
sass-scss才是最受欢迎的吧,记得去掉有个统计说框架类,sass占50%多,less才20%多
返回顶部
顶部